Overview Dental Receptionist Greenville Root Canal Specialist We are seeking a friendly and organized Dental Receptionist to join our dedicated team. You'll be the first point of contact for our patients, playing a vital role in delivering an excellent patient experience and supporting the smooth operation of our dental practice. Schedule: Part Time, Monday - Thursday 7AM-12PM & Friday 7:30AM - 1:00PM Responsibilities Greet patients warmly and ensure a welcoming, professional environment Schedule and confirm appointments, manage provider calendars Answer phone calls, respond to inquiries, and manage patient communication Verify insurance coverage and obtain necessary pre-authorizations Process payments, handle billing, and maintain accurate financial records Maintain patient records and ensure accurate data entry Coordinate patient flow and assist with administrative support as needed Ensure compliance with patient confidentiality and HIPAA regulations Perform routine cleaning and maintenance of workspaces to endure a safe and sanitary environment Regularly disinfecting surfaces, organizing supplies, and maintaining general cleanliness in accordance with company standards Supporting team efforts to uphold hygiene and cleanliness in all shared and individual areas Please note that additional responsibilities may be assigned Qualifications Requirements High school diploma or equivalent 1 years of customer service experience Preferred Skills Excellent communication and customer service skills Reliable, organized, and detail-oriented Experience with dental practice management software Proficiency with computers, including Microsoft Office applications Knowledge of dental insurance and billing procedures We Offer Competitive Compensation Benefits Package: Medical, Dental, Vision, 401K, Flexible Spending Accounts and much more!
